EGGS..HARDBOILED
I tried one thing. ONE. Eggs. My sister-in-law waned on me until I caved. She literally typed the entire instruction list in a text and said it was easy to make eggs. 1c water, add trivet, add eggs, 5 minutes high pressure, 5 minutes Natural Pressure Release, fully release remaining pressure (using the scary valve), 5 minutes in an ice water bath, eat eggs. Sounded like too many steps right? But in truth, it wasn’t actually so bad. And…dangggg–it worked. They came out perfect. Shells didn’t stick, yolks were yellow with zero gray, and it didn’t take much effort.
